Mikhail Filiponenko, a pro-Russian lawmaker and ex-militiaman in occupied jap Ukraine, walked over to a automotive exterior his home on Wednesday morning … and was promptly blown to smithereens, Russian media reported.
Ukraine’s Navy Intelligence instantly claimed accountability for the assassination.
“Yeah, it was our operation,” Andriy Cherniak, consultant of Ukraine’s Navy Intelligence Directorate, also referred to as GUR, informed POLITICO in a cellphone dialog in regards to the automotive bomb assault.
Navy intelligence labored along with native Ukrainian partisans to arrange to assassinate Filiponenko, GUR mentioned in a press release.
Filiponenko was born in Luhansk and studied in Kyiv. Nevertheless, in 2014 he joined Russian-backed mercenaries who seized energy and helped President Vladimir Putin and the Kremlin to determine its rule over the occupied territories of Luhansk and Donetsk, in jap Ukraine.
“He was concerned within the group of torture camps within the occupied territories of the Luhansk area, the place prisoners of battle and civilian hostages have been subjected to inhumane torture. Filiponenko himself personally brutally tortured folks,” Ukraine’s army intelligence mentioned.
GUR revealed the precise tackle the place Filiponenko lived in Luhansk and added that Ukraine’s spies knew the place different high-profile collaborators have been residing within the occupied territories.
“All battle criminals might be punished,” GUR mentioned.
